Documentation (history)

The M1 Garand (formally US rifle, caliber .30, M1, Rifle, Caliber .30, M1 or US Rifle, Cal. .30, M1) is a .30 caliber semi-automatic rifle that was the standard service rifle of the United States. United during World War II and the Korean War and also saw limited service during the Vietnam War.
